U.S. Historical Usage
The name Marcelle was first seen in the United States in 1894.
Marcelle has ranked as high as #714 nationally, which occurred in 1920, and has been most popular in New York, California, Massachusetts, Louisiana, and Illinois.
In the past 5 years the name Marcelle has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.

Popularity Over Time (National) — Table
We track the national popularity of each baby name annually. The table below displays each year along with the number of births reported by the Social Security Administration. This data combines all state-level reporting from the SSA's baby names database to provide a comprehensive view of overall birth counts for Marcelle.
| Year | Births |
|---|---|
| 2024 | 9 |
| 2023 | 10 |
| 2022 | 16 |
| 2021 | 6 |
| 2020 | 13 |
| 2019 | 12 |
| 2018 | 6 |
| 2017 | 14 |
| 2016 | 17 |
| 2015 | 8 |
| 2014 | 8 |
| 2013 | 10 |
| 2012 | 9 |
| 2011 | 8 |
| 2010 | 15 |
| 2009 | 8 |
| 2008 | 14 |
| 2007 | 10 |
| 2006 | 12 |
| 2005 | 17 |
| 2004 | 13 |
| 2003 | 7 |
| 2002 | 17 |
| 2001 | 11 |
| 2000 | 13 |
| 1999 | 18 |
| 1998 | 23 |
| 1997 | 24 |
| 1996 | 17 |
| 1995 | 29 |
| 1994 | 21 |
| 1993 | 10 |
| 1992 | 24 |
| 1991 | 19 |
| 1990 | 22 |
| 1989 | 25 |
| 1988 | 24 |
| 1987 | 24 |
| 1986 | 26 |
| 1985 | 23 |
| 1984 | 21 |
| 1983 | 26 |
| 1982 | 29 |
| 1981 | 39 |
| 1980 | 42 |
| 1979 | 41 |
| 1978 | 29 |
| 1977 | 22 |
| 1976 | 19 |
| 1975 | 37 |
| 1974 | 40 |
| 1973 | 38 |
| 1972 | 55 |
| 1971 | 74 |
| 1970 | 55 |
| 1969 | 58 |
| 1968 | 64 |
| 1967 | 71 |
| 1966 | 65 |
| 1965 | 70 |
| 1964 | 64 |
| 1963 | 83 |
| 1962 | 65 |
| 1961 | 74 |
| 1960 | 61 |
| 1959 | 68 |
| 1958 | 60 |
| 1957 | 67 |
| 1956 | 65 |
| 1955 | 62 |
| 1954 | 70 |
| 1953 | 57 |
| 1952 | 54 |
| 1951 | 56 |
| 1950 | 59 |
| 1949 | 56 |
| 1948 | 63 |
| 1947 | 51 |
| 1946 | 37 |
| 1945 | 35 |
| 1944 | 43 |
| 1943 | 44 |
| 1942 | 41 |
| 1941 | 37 |
| 1940 | 32 |
| 1939 | 41 |
| 1938 | 30 |
| 1937 | 38 |
| 1936 | 45 |
| 1935 | 39 |
| 1934 | 46 |
| 1933 | 51 |
| 1932 | 52 |
| 1931 | 60 |
| 1930 | 76 |
| 1929 | 68 |
| 1928 | 91 |
| 1927 | 99 |
| 1926 | 105 |
| 1925 | 91 |
| 1924 | 135 |
| 1923 | 142 |
| 1922 | 121 |
| 1921 | 146 |
| 1920 | 177 |
| 1919 | 148 |
| 1918 | 144 |
| 1917 | 90 |
| 1916 | 70 |
| 1915 | 60 |
| 1914 | 43 |
| 1913 | 48 |
| 1912 | 40 |
| 1911 | 23 |
| 1910 | 23 |
| 1909 | 10 |
| 1908 | 19 |
| 1907 | 18 |
| 1906 | 13 |
| 1905 | 13 |
| 1904 | 17 |
| 1903 | 14 |
| 1902 | 7 |
| 1901 | 6 |
| 1899 | 7 |
| 1898 | 9 |
| 1895 | 6 |
| 1894 | 5 |
